About Us From very humble beginnings in 1942, Hollywood has evolved into a modern facility. In recent years we have significantly grown to become the largest hospital in WA with more than 900 licenced beds. Hollywood is also the largest private hospital in Australia. The Hospital is owned and operated by Ramsay Health Care, a global operator of private hospitals and primary care clinics with 72 Australian sites employing over 34,000 people.
